another update

Slowly progressing this thing further, i originally wanted to put the devil breaking out of the front nose, but it looked tacky when i put it into pencil on the bike, so instead decided to use the entire windscreen and use the surround later as a window or portal (which will get done soon)...

All the first layer is being done in black tint, the colours will be added later once the entire bike is put into black tint (best way to do it)...
